Beyond direct investment in cryptocurrencies, the concept of "staking" has emerged as a powerful method for generating passive income. Staking involves locking up a certain amount of cryptocurrency to support the operations of a blockchain network. In return for your contribution, you receive rewards, often in the form of more of the same cryptocurrency. This model is particularly prevalent in blockchains that utilize a Proof-of-Stake (PoS) consensus mechanism, which is more energy-efficient than the Proof-of-Work (PoW) system used by Bitcoin. Staking allows your digital assets to work for you, generating returns without requiring active trading. Different staking platforms and protocols offer varying rewards and lock-up periods, so diligent research into their security and historical performance is paramount.

The burgeoning field of Decentralized Finance (DeFi) presents another rich vein for blockchain-powered profit. DeFi aims to recreate traditional financial services – lending, borrowing, trading, insurance – on decentralized blockchain networks, removing intermediaries like banks. For individuals, this can mean earning higher interest rates on their crypto holdings through lending protocols, or accessing collateralized loans with their digital assets. Yield farming and liquidity mining are advanced DeFi strategies where users provide liquidity to decentralized exchanges or lending platforms in exchange for rewards, often in the form of governance tokens. While these strategies can offer exceptionally high returns, they also come with elevated risks, including smart contract vulnerabilities, impermanent loss, and market fluctuations. A thorough understanding of the specific protocols, their security audits, and the inherent risks is non-negotiable.

For individuals looking to enter the cryptocurrency market, the first crucial step is establishing a secure and reliable way to acquire and store digital assets. This involves choosing a reputable cryptocurrency exchange. Factors to consider include the exchange's security measures, the range of cryptocurrencies offered, transaction fees, and ease of use. Once you've selected an exchange, you'll need to set up an account, which typically involves identity verification. After purchasing your desired cryptocurrencies, the next vital decision is how to store them. While exchanges offer convenience, holding large amounts of crypto on an exchange can expose you to risks if the exchange is compromised. This is where hardware wallets come into play. Hardware wallets are physical devices that store your private keys offline, making them the most secure option for long-term holding. Understanding private keys and public addresses is fundamental; your private key is your access to your funds, and it must be kept secret.

Decentralized Finance (DeFi) presents opportunities for generating yield on your digital assets, but it's also the most complex and potentially risky area. Participating in DeFi typically involves interacting with smart contracts, which are self-executing agreements on the blockchain. Lending and borrowing platforms, decentralized exchanges (DEXs), and yield farming protocols are key components. Earning interest on your crypto holdings by lending them out through platforms like Aave or Compound is a relatively straightforward way to generate passive income, but always consider the smart contract risk and the potential for platform failure. Liquidity providing, where you deposit pairs of cryptocurrencies into a DEX to facilitate trades, can offer attractive rewards, but you must understand impermanent loss – the risk that the value of your deposited assets will decrease compared to simply holding them. Yield farming, often involving complex strategies of moving assets between different protocols to maximize returns, can offer the highest yields but also carries the most significant risks, including smart contract exploits and rug pulls (where project developers abandon a project and run off with investors' funds). Thorough due diligence on every protocol you interact with, including auditing its smart contracts and understanding its governance model, is non-negotiable.

The concept of "digital identity" is also undergoing a radical transformation. In Web2, our digital identities are fragmented across various platforms, often relying on centralized login systems like "Sign in with Google" or "Sign in with Facebook." This grants these companies significant control over our online presence. Web3 is moving towards self-sovereign identity, where individuals have complete control over their digital credentials. Using technologies like decentralized identifiers (DIDs) and verifiable credentials, users can selectively share information about themselves without revealing unnecessary personal data. This enhances privacy, security, and user autonomy, allowing for a more secure and personalized online experience. You can prove you are over 18 without revealing your birthdate, or prove you have a specific qualification without sharing your full academic record.
